    Steve Martini (born 1911 or 1912; died October 7, 1984) was a barber.Initially working in the Pennsylvania Hotel in New York and moving on the The Pentagon, he began working in the White House in 1959 and cut the hair of United States presidents Dwight D. Eisenhower, John F. Kennedy, Lyndon B. Johnson and Richard Nixon.

    Maximilian Carlo Martini (born December 11, 1969) [1] [2] is an American actor. He is known for his roles as Corporal Fred Henderson in Saving Private Ryan , Wiley in Level 9 , First Sergeant Sid Wojo in The Great Raid , and as Master Sergeant Mack Gerhardt in the CBS military drama television series The Unit .
